The FBI called a fingerprint match '100%'—and arrested the wrong man.

AFIS candidate → examiner confirmation → investigation and detention → Spanish police identify the true source

After the March 2004 Madrid train bombings, the FBI entered a latent fingerprint from a bag associated with the attack into its Automated Fingerprint Identification System. Brandon Mayfield, an attorney in Portland, Oregon, emerged as a candidate. FBI examiners then concluded that Mayfield's print matched the latent print and treated the identification as certain.

The FBI opened an investigation, obtained warrants and arrested Mayfield as a material witness. He was detained for approximately two weeks. Spanish National Police had already reached a negative conclusion on the Mayfield comparison; they later identified Algerian national Ouhnane Daoud as the actual source of the latent print, and the FBI withdrew its identification.

The Justice Department Inspector General concluded that unusual similarity between the prints contributed to the error, but also found examiner mistakes, circular reasoning, excessive reliance on tiny details, overlooked discrepancies and overconfidence that prevented the FBI from adequately reconsidering the match after Spanish police disagreed.

Why it matters: A biometric system can produce a candidate; human experts can then turn that candidate into institutional certainty. The danger is not only an algorithmic false positive—it is what happens when people begin reasoning from the assumption that the biometric must be right.
